Transaction c2393337a042401e05ed2d9d799f4ebe3417afe42f1e27f1862d7e2b1b766479
1 Input
1 Output
-
c2393337a042401e05ed2d9d799f4ebe3417afe42f1e27f1862d7e2b1b766479:0
- value
- 17567683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e21c77156b179a50a1bc18a40dd36b9e2180c2ef OP_EQUAL
- address
- 3NJajh6ey6kxCJ5GJST9J4HBUyW3ozw1bN